Abstract :
ELIMINATION of zero drift in magnetic modulators has taken two courses. The first involves using the second-harmonic flux components in two equally rated saturable-reactor elements which secure decoupling between a-c excitation windings and d-c signal windings.1–10 Since, in these twin-core modulators, the second-harmonic component of output voltage is generally selected by filtering and used for controlling a tuned a-c amplifier, the relatively high residual noise-output voltage, caused by slight core mismatch, places stringent requirements on both filter and amplifier circuits.
